共享10億微信用戶,簡(jiǎn)單,實(shí)用,傳播快
小程序開(kāi)發(fā)發(fā)布時(shí)間:2025-01-08 瀏覽次數(shù):208
隨著小程序應(yīng)用的日益廣泛,數(shù)據(jù)存儲(chǔ)與安全成為了小程序開(kāi)發(fā)公司必須重視的關(guān)鍵環(huán)節(jié)。合理的數(shù)據(jù)存儲(chǔ)架構(gòu)能夠保障小程序高效運(yùn)行,而完善的安全策略則可保護(hù)用戶隱私、維護(hù)品牌聲譽(yù),以下將詳細(xì)探討小程序開(kāi)發(fā)制作中的相關(guān)要點(diǎn)。
一、數(shù)據(jù)存儲(chǔ)策略
本地存儲(chǔ):小程序提供了本地緩存機(jī)制,用于存儲(chǔ)一些小型、頻繁使用的數(shù)據(jù),以提升用戶體驗(yàn)。例如,用戶的登錄狀態(tài)、偏好設(shè)置、少量瀏覽歷史等可以存儲(chǔ)在本地。利用 wx.setStorageSync 和 wx.getStorageSync 等 API,小程序開(kāi)發(fā)公司能便捷地對(duì)本地?cái)?shù)據(jù)進(jìn)行讀寫(xiě)操作。但需注意本地存儲(chǔ)的容量限制,通常為幾兆字節(jié),要合理規(guī)劃存儲(chǔ)內(nèi)容,避免超出限額影響小程序性能。此外,對(duì)于敏感數(shù)據(jù),如用戶密碼,切勿直接存儲(chǔ)在本地,以防設(shè)備丟失或被惡意獲取時(shí)造成信息泄露。
云存儲(chǔ):借助云開(kāi)發(fā)平臺(tái)(如騰訊云、阿里云等提供的小程序云服務(wù))實(shí)現(xiàn)大規(guī)模數(shù)據(jù)存儲(chǔ)是當(dāng)前主流做法。云存儲(chǔ)適合存放圖片、視頻、文檔等體積較大或需長(zhǎng)期保存的數(shù)據(jù)。以電商小程序?yàn)槔唐穲D片、詳情介紹文檔等都可上傳至云存儲(chǔ)。小程序開(kāi)發(fā)公司通過(guò)相應(yīng)云 API 進(jìn)行上傳、下載、刪除等操作,并且云存儲(chǔ)具備高擴(kuò)展性,能隨著小程序業(yè)務(wù)增長(zhǎng)輕松擴(kuò)容。同時(shí),云存儲(chǔ)提供了冗余備份功能,可有效防止數(shù)據(jù)因硬件故障、自然災(zāi)害等意外情況丟失。
數(shù)據(jù)庫(kù)存儲(chǔ):關(guān)系型數(shù)據(jù)庫(kù)(如 MySQL)或非關(guān)系型數(shù)據(jù)庫(kù)(如 MongoDB)常用于存儲(chǔ)結(jié)構(gòu)化數(shù)據(jù),滿足復(fù)雜業(yè)務(wù)需求。在小程序開(kāi)發(fā)制作中,用戶信息、訂單數(shù)據(jù)、商品庫(kù)存等通常存于數(shù)據(jù)庫(kù)。以社交小程序?yàn)槔?,用戶的個(gè)人資料、好友關(guān)系、動(dòng)態(tài)信息等需結(jié)構(gòu)化存儲(chǔ)以便高效查詢與管理。使用數(shù)據(jù)庫(kù)時(shí),要精心設(shè)計(jì)表結(jié)構(gòu),優(yōu)化查詢語(yǔ)句,避免數(shù)據(jù)冗余,提高數(shù)據(jù)檢索效率。對(duì)于高并發(fā)讀寫(xiě)場(chǎng)景,如電商促銷(xiāo)活動(dòng)期間大量訂單生成,還需采取數(shù)據(jù)庫(kù)集群、讀寫(xiě)分離等技術(shù)確保數(shù)據(jù)的及時(shí)性與準(zhǔn)確性。
二、數(shù)據(jù)安全策略
傳輸加密:小程序與服務(wù)器之間的數(shù)據(jù)傳輸必須采用加密協(xié)議,如 HTTPS。確保用戶登錄、注冊(cè)、支付等涉及敏感信息的操作在加密通道中進(jìn)行,防止數(shù)據(jù)被竊取或篡改。配置服務(wù)器證書(shū)時(shí),要選用權(quán)威機(jī)構(gòu)頒發(fā)的有效證書(shū),避免因證書(shū)問(wèn)題引發(fā)用戶信任危機(jī)。此外,對(duì)于部分對(duì)安全要求極高的小程序,如金融類(lèi),還可考慮采用雙向認(rèn)證,進(jìn)一步增強(qiáng)傳輸安全性。
身份驗(yàn)證:建立嚴(yán)格的用戶身份驗(yàn)證機(jī)制,防止非法用戶訪問(wèn)小程序資源。常見(jiàn)的驗(yàn)證方式包括用戶名密碼登錄、手機(jī)號(hào)驗(yàn)證碼登錄、第三方賬號(hào)授權(quán)登錄(如微信登錄)等。在用戶名密碼登錄場(chǎng)景下,強(qiáng)制要求用戶設(shè)置高強(qiáng)度密碼,并定期提示用戶更換密碼;對(duì)于手機(jī)號(hào)驗(yàn)證碼登錄,確保驗(yàn)證碼的時(shí)效性(一般為幾分鐘)與隨機(jī)性,防止驗(yàn)證碼被破解復(fù)用。同時(shí),對(duì)用戶登錄行為進(jìn)行監(jiān)測(cè),如發(fā)現(xiàn)異常登錄嘗試(如短時(shí)間內(nèi)多次異地登錄),及時(shí)凍結(jié)賬戶并通知用戶。
訪問(wèn)控制:依據(jù)用戶角色與權(quán)限對(duì)小程序內(nèi)的數(shù)據(jù)和功能進(jìn)行精細(xì)化訪問(wèn)控制。以企業(yè)辦公小程序?yàn)槔?,普通員工、部門(mén)主管、企業(yè)高管所能訪問(wèn)的功能模塊與數(shù)據(jù)范圍應(yīng)各不相同。通過(guò)后端服務(wù)器配置權(quán)限列表,在用戶請(qǐng)求訪問(wèn)時(shí),核對(duì)其權(quán)限,只允許合法訪問(wèn)。對(duì)于敏感數(shù)據(jù)操作,如修改用戶密碼、刪除重要訂單,采用二次確認(rèn)機(jī)制,即除了驗(yàn)證用戶身份,還要求用戶輸入額外的驗(yàn)證信息(如短信驗(yàn)證碼、動(dòng)態(tài)口令),降低誤操作與惡意操作風(fēng)險(xiǎn)。
數(shù)據(jù)備份與恢復(fù):制定定期的數(shù)據(jù)備份計(jì)劃,確保數(shù)據(jù)在遭遇災(zāi)難(如服務(wù)器崩潰、數(shù)據(jù)被惡意刪除)時(shí)能夠快速恢復(fù)。備份頻率應(yīng)根據(jù)數(shù)據(jù)更新頻率與重要性確定,例如對(duì)于電商小程序的訂單數(shù)據(jù),可能需要每日備份甚至實(shí)時(shí)備份;而對(duì)于一些靜態(tài)的配置數(shù)據(jù),可每周備份一次。同時(shí),定期進(jìn)行恢復(fù)演練,檢驗(yàn)備份數(shù)據(jù)的完整性與可用性,確保在關(guān)鍵時(shí)刻能夠真正發(fā)揮作用。
安全漏洞檢測(cè)與修復(fù):持續(xù)關(guān)注小程序開(kāi)發(fā)框架、依賴(lài)庫(kù)以及服務(wù)器軟件的安全動(dòng)態(tài),及時(shí)發(fā)現(xiàn)并修復(fù)潛在的安全漏洞。定期使用專(zhuān)業(yè)的安全檢測(cè)工具(如騰訊云漏洞掃描、Nessus 等)對(duì)小程序進(jìn)行全面掃描,包括代碼漏洞、配置漏洞、網(wǎng)絡(luò)漏洞等。一旦發(fā)現(xiàn)漏洞,立即組織開(kāi)發(fā)團(tuán)隊(duì)依據(jù)漏洞嚴(yán)重程度與修復(fù)難度制定修復(fù)方案,優(yōu)先修復(fù)高危漏洞,避免被黑客利用造成安全事故。
在小程序開(kāi)發(fā)制作過(guò)程中,數(shù)據(jù)存儲(chǔ)與安全是相輔相成的兩大核心任務(wù)。小程序開(kāi)發(fā)公司需綜合運(yùn)用多種技術(shù)手段,從數(shù)據(jù)存儲(chǔ)架構(gòu)設(shè)計(jì)到安全防護(hù)體系構(gòu)建,全方面保障小程序數(shù)據(jù)的完整性、可用性與保密性,為小程序的穩(wěn)定運(yùn)營(yíng)與用戶信任奠定堅(jiān)實(shí)基礎(chǔ)。
小程序開(kāi)發(fā)制作不僅是企業(yè)數(shù)字化轉(zhuǎn)型的重要工具,更是實(shí)現(xiàn)業(yè)務(wù)增長(zhǎng)300%的關(guān)鍵利器。通過(guò)精準(zhǔn)用戶觸達(dá)、優(yōu)化用戶體驗(yàn)、數(shù)據(jù)驅(qū)動(dòng)運(yùn)營(yíng)和營(yíng)銷(xiāo)工具賦能,企業(yè)可以在激烈的市場(chǎng)競(jìng)爭(zhēng)中脫穎而出。
利用小程序開(kāi)發(fā)制作促進(jìn)品牌與用戶互動(dòng),恰似編織一張緊密且多元的 “互動(dòng)之網(wǎng)”,從體驗(yàn)個(gè)性化 “織線”、功能多元化 “結(jié)扣”、活動(dòng)實(shí)時(shí)化 “紋理”、反饋高效化 “加固” 到權(quán)益專(zhuān)屬化 “點(diǎn)綴”,深層次拉近品牌與用戶距離。
增加小程序開(kāi)發(fā)制作用戶粘性需要從多個(gè)方面入手,綜合運(yùn)用個(gè)性化體驗(yàn)、內(nèi)容更新、激勵(lì)機(jī)制、交互優(yōu)化和社交互動(dòng)等多種有效方法。在實(shí)際的小程序開(kāi)發(fā)和運(yùn)營(yíng)過(guò)程中,要深入了解用戶需求和行為習(xí)慣,不斷創(chuàng)新和優(yōu)化各項(xiàng)策略,為用戶提供持續(xù)的價(jià)值和良好的體驗(yàn),
在小程序開(kāi)發(fā)制作過(guò)程中,收集用戶反饋信息是至關(guān)重要的一環(huán)。這不僅有助于開(kāi)發(fā)者了解用戶的實(shí)際需求和痛點(diǎn),還能及時(shí)發(fā)現(xiàn)產(chǎn)品中存在的問(wèn)題,從而進(jìn)行有針對(duì)性的優(yōu)化和改進(jìn),提升用戶體驗(yàn)。
制定小程序開(kāi)發(fā)制作的流程與規(guī)范是確保項(xiàng)目順利進(jìn)行、提高開(kāi)發(fā)效率、保證產(chǎn)品質(zhì)量的重要手段。通過(guò)明確開(kāi)發(fā)流程、制定詳細(xì)的規(guī)范和標(biāo)準(zhǔn)、加強(qiáng)培訓(xùn)與指導(dǎo)、監(jiān)督與檢查以及持續(xù)改進(jìn)等措施,可以有效提高小程序的開(kāi)發(fā)質(zhì)量和用戶體驗(yàn)。
生活服務(wù)類(lèi)小程序開(kāi)發(fā)制作在當(dāng)前數(shù)字化時(shí)代蘊(yùn)含著巨大的市場(chǎng)機(jī)會(huì)。這類(lèi)小程序通過(guò)提供便捷、高效的服務(wù),滿足了人們?nèi)粘I钪械母鞣N需求,如餐飲、購(gòu)物、娛樂(lè)、出行等,不僅提升了用戶的生活體驗(yàn),也為創(chuàng)業(yè)者、企業(yè)和開(kāi)發(fā)者提供了廣闊的商業(yè)空間。
在移動(dòng)互聯(lián)網(wǎng)的浪潮中,小程序作為一種新興的應(yīng)用形態(tài),正逐漸改變著人們的生活方式。它以其獨(dú)特的優(yōu)勢(shì),如開(kāi)發(fā)成本低、使用方便、推廣快速等,吸引了眾多企業(yè)和開(kāi)發(fā)者的關(guān)注。然而,小程序的生態(tài)系統(tǒng)也面臨著諸多挑戰(zhàn)。
隨著技術(shù)的不斷進(jìn)步和消費(fèi)者需求的不斷變化,小程序與實(shí)體店的結(jié)合將更加緊密和深入。實(shí)體店需要不斷創(chuàng)新和優(yōu)化,以適應(yīng)市場(chǎng)的變化和發(fā)展趨勢(shì)。同時(shí),也需要關(guān)注新技術(shù)和新模式的應(yīng)用,如人工智能、大數(shù)據(jù)等,為實(shí)體店的發(fā)展注入新的活力和動(dòng)力。
在微信小程序開(kāi)發(fā)制作過(guò)程中,開(kāi)發(fā)者可能會(huì)遇到各種常見(jiàn)錯(cuò)誤。這些錯(cuò)誤可能源于代碼編寫(xiě)、配置設(shè)置、接口調(diào)用、用戶體驗(yàn)設(shè)計(jì)等多個(gè)方面。
黨建小程序開(kāi)發(fā)為黨建工作提供了新的思路和手段。通過(guò)不斷優(yōu)化功能設(shè)計(jì)、提升用戶體驗(yàn)、拓展應(yīng)用場(chǎng)景等措施,黨建小程序?qū)⒊蔀辄h員服務(wù)的新窗口、黨建工作的新陣地。
微信小程序開(kāi)發(fā),小程序開(kāi)發(fā),微信開(kāi)發(fā),小程序商城開(kāi)發(fā),分銷(xiāo)系統(tǒng)開(kāi)發(fā),APP開(kāi)發(fā),軟件開(kāi)發(fā),公眾號(hào)開(kāi)發(fā),促進(jìn)公司發(fā)展,提升品牌競(jìng)爭(zhēng)力,將情感融入用戶體驗(yàn),走向市場(chǎng)新格局!